Farm to table deliciousness! My husband booked this place for my son’s graduation dinner. We had a large party so we opted for a private room and you could play your own music. You could see the beautiful land of the farm and the gorgeous sunset from the room. We had a 5 course meal. First, I would like to say that the service was outstanding. Sara really took care of us, attended to our needs and continued to fill our glass water jugs. I started off with margarita to drink, mushrooms with hummus, pork skewers, and then egg drop soup with turkey broth and vegetables. The Caesar spinach salad was very fresh with radishes and parmesan crips, for my main, I had the trout with (mussel-did not open and ran out) but the fish and bread were outstanding- well flavored and cooked perfectly. My husband had the tender pork shoulder. We finished our meals with decaf french press, fresh cream, and creme brûlée. Everyone enjoyed their meals and my son was very happy. We highly recommend this place.

Beautiful dining experience! The staff is knowledgeable and customizes your meal to your desires. Most ingredients come right from the farm nearby, which you can stroll around before and after dinner. We had the pleasure of sitting outside while the sun was setting over the mountains and valley. Gorgeous, amazing dining experience. Fun for the whole family! Our kids loved the chickens and the hammock. Highly recommend! Excellent

Attended a private event. The setting is spectacular--and not at all far from downtown State College (very close to airport). This is a genuine farm, nothing fabricated here. The timber frame structure is truly transporting and welcoming. All of the staff and accommodations reflect attention to detail that made our event special. Looking forward to returning soon!

I had my moms 65th birthday celebration at the RE Farm and it was amazing. Duke was so easy to work with in planning the event and we decided on renting a small room inside for brunch. The setting was beautiful, they had flowers from the farm on the table and music playing. We had a three course brunch and it was incredible, some of the best food I’ve had. We were able to walk around the farm a little after we ate, it’s so picturesque! Overall such a great experience and you cannot beat these prices. I would highly recommend a visit for a meal or an event!
